Election Information & Dates:

June 8, 2010 Primary Election - Offices

  • Nomination Period Opens: Tuesday, February 16, 2010 (Offices Closed Feb. 15-Presidents Day)
  • Candidates may begin filing papers including
     
    • Nomination Petition (20-30 valid signatures)
    • Statement of Economic Interests Form 700
    • Acceptance/Rejection of Public Financing
    • Candidate Statement
    • For more details go to the "City Offices to be Filed" page
 
  • Materials are available free of charge at the City Clerk's Office (by appointment)
  • Final Filing Day: Friday, March 12, 2010 by 4:30 p.m. at the City Clerk's Office
  • If incumbent does not file by March 12, 2010, deadline for that office extends to

Wednesday, March 17, 2010 by 4:30 p.m.

  • Last Day to Register - May 24, 2010

June 8, 2010 Primary Election - Measures

  • Government Accountability and Charter Reform Measure of 2009 (Strong Mayor) (view document) PDF Document
    • Approved for placement on June 2010 ballot by City Council on August 6, 2009.
    • Measure to be called to ballot in January of 2010.
